One of the most accessible and popular ways to generate passive income with blockchain is through cryptocurrency staking. Staking is akin to earning interest on your digital assets. When you hold certain cryptocurrencies, you can "stake" them by locking them up in a network's wallet to support its operations. In return for your contribution to the network's security and efficiency, you are rewarded with more of that cryptocurrency. Different cryptocurrencies use various consensus mechanisms, with Proof-of-Stake (PoS) being the most relevant for staking. Projects like Cardano, Solana, and Ethereum (post-merge) utilize PoS, offering attractive annual percentage yields (APYs) that can significantly outpace traditional savings accounts. The beauty of staking is its relative simplicity. Once you've acquired the staked cryptocurrency, the process of delegating or directly staking is often a few clicks away within a compatible wallet or exchange. The rewards accrue automatically, making it a truly passive endeavor. However, it's crucial to research the specific cryptocurrency, its long-term viability, and the associated risks, as the value of the staked asset can fluctuate.
Beyond staking, yield farming represents a more advanced, and potentially more lucrative, avenue for passive income within the decentralized finance (DeFi) ecosystem. DeFi refers to financial applications built on blockchain technology, aiming to recreate traditional financial services like lending, borrowing, and trading without centralized intermediaries. Yield farming involves provid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ges (DEXs) or lending protocols. When you provide liquidity – meaning you deposit a pair of cryptocurrencies into a liquidity pool – you enable others to trade or borrow assets. For this service, you are rewarded with a share of the trading fees generated by the pool, and often, with additional governance tokens from the protocol itself. These tokens can have intrinsic value and can sometimes be staked further to earn even more rewards. Yield farming can offer incredibly high APYs, sometimes in the triple or even quadruple digits. However, it comes with higher risks, including impermanent loss (where the value of your deposited assets can decrease compared to simply holding them), smart contract vulnerabilities, and the volatility of the underlying tokens. It requires a deeper understanding of DeFi protocols and a more active management approach, though once set up, it can generate passive income.
Another exciting frontier in blockchain for passive wealth lies in non-fungible tokens (NFTs). While often associated with digital art and collectibles, NFTs are unique digital assets that represent ownership of a specific item, whether digital or physical. The passive income potential with NFTs is multifaceted. One way is through royalties. When an NFT creator sells their artwork on a marketplace, they can program a royalty percentage into the smart contract. This means that every time the NFT is resold on the secondary market, the original creator automatically receives a percentage of the sale price. This creates a perpetual stream of passive income for artists and collectors. Beyond royalties, some NFT projects are evolving to incorporate staking mechanisms directly. Holders of certain NFTs can stake their tokens to earn rewards, often in the form of the project's native cryptocurrency. This blurs the lines between digital collectibles and income-generating assets, offering a novel way to monetize ownership of unique digital items. Furthermore, the concept of fractionalized NFTs is emerging, allowing multiple individuals to co-own a high-value NFT and share in the passive income it generates, democratizing access to potentially lucrative digital assets.
The underlying technology enabling these passive income streams is smart contracts. These are self-executing contracts with the terms of the agreement directly written into code. They run on the blockchain and automatically execute actions when predefined conditions are met. For instance, a smart contract can be programmed to automatically distribute staking rewards to participants at regular intervals, or to send royalties to an NFT creator whenever a sale occurs. This automation eliminates the need for manual intervention, making passive income generation seamless and trustless. The development and deployment of smart contracts have been instrumental in the explosion of DeFi and the creation of innovative passive income models.

One of the most fundamental passive income generators within the blockchain space, beyond direct staking, is through lending and borrowing protocols. Decentralized lending platforms, powered by smart contracts, allow users to lend their crypto assets to borrowers and earn interest. Think of it as a peer-to-peer bank, but without the bank. Users deposit their digital assets into lending pools, and borrowers can then take out loans against their own crypto collateral. The interest rates are typically determined by supply and demand, offering potentially higher returns than traditional savings accounts. Platforms like Aave, Compound, and MakerDAO are pioneers in this space. The process is remarkably passive; once your assets are deposited, the smart contract handles the distribution of interest. The primary risk here lies in the volatility of the collateral and the smart contract's security. However, these platforms often incorporate robust risk management mechanisms. For those looking to generate passive income with their existing crypto holdings, lending is a straightforward and effective strategy.
The concept of automated market makers (AMMs), which are central to decentralized exchanges (DEXs) and are intrinsically linked to yield farming, deserves further examination. AMMs replace traditional order books with liquidity pools and algorithmic pricing. When you provide liquidity to an AMM, you are essentially enabling trades to happen. The fees generated from these trades are then distributed proportionally to the liquidity providers. While this is the core of yield farming, the "passive" aspect comes into play as the smart contract automatically accrues your share of the fees. The act of depositing your assets into a liquidity pool is the primary "work," after which the system takes over. Understanding the impermanent loss is crucial here; it's the potential loss in value compared to simply holding the assets. However, if the trading volume in the pool is high and the fees generated outweigh the impermanent loss, it can be a very profitable passive income strategy. Furthermore, many DEXs offer additional incentives in the form of their native governance tokens to liquidity providers, amplifying the passive yield potential.
Emerging from the NFT space are concepts like play-to-earn (P2E) gaming with passive elements. While P2E games require active participation to earn, many are incorporating features where in-game assets (often NFTs) can be staked or rented out to other players for passive income. For example, a player might own a rare in-game sword (an NFT). Instead of actively using it, they can rent it out to another player who needs it for their quests, earning a percentage of the in-game currency or rewards generated by the borrower. Similarly, land or other virtual assets in metaverse platforms can be staked or leased for passive returns. This represents a novel intersection of digital ownership, gaming, and passive income, where your virtual assets can become income-generating tools.
Beyond individual asset-based income generation, dec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) offer a unique, albeit more complex, pathway to passive income, often through governance and participation. DAOs are organizations run by code and community consensus, with decisions made through token-based voting. Holding governance tokens of certain DAOs can entitle you to a share of the DAO's treasury or profits generated through its operations. While this might require some initial engagement to understand the DAO's goals and governance structure, once you hold the tokens, you can passively benefit from the collective success of the organization. Some DAOs are specifically designed to generate yield through various DeFi strategies, and token holders benefit from these profits. This is a more indirect form of passive income but reflects the broader decentralization trend where community ownership translates into financial rewards.
The integration of real-world assets (RWAs) onto the blockchain is another groundbreaking development that will significantly expand passive income opportunities. Tokenization allows for the representation of tangible assets like real estate, art, or even commodities as digital tokens on a blockchain. This enables fractional ownership, making high-value assets accessible to a broader audience. Imagine owning a fraction of a luxury apartment complex that generates rental income. Through tokenization, that rental income can be automatically distributed to token holders proportionally, creating a passive income stream derived from a physical asset. This process also enhances liquidity and transparency for these assets, opening up new avenues for investment and passive wealth accumulation.

Risk management within the Crypto Rich Mindset is an ongoing process, not a one-time setup. This involves regularly reviewing and rebalancing a portfolio to maintain the desired asset allocation. As some assets grow significantly, they might come to represent a larger percentage of the portfolio than initially intended, thus increasing overall risk. The proactive investor will trim these positions and reallocate those profits to other areas, ensuring that the portfolio remains balanced and aligned with their risk tolerance. Moreover, this mindset emphasizes the importance of setting clear exit strategies. This doesn't mean selling at the first sign of profit, but having pre-determined price targets or fundamental shifts in a project’s trajectory that would trigger a sale. This disciplined approach prevents emotional decision-making during volatile market conditions and helps to lock in gains.
The Crypto Rich Mindset also champions the adoption of robust security practices. In the digital realm, the security of one's assets is paramount. This involves understanding the difference between custodial and non-custodial wallets, and choosing the security solution that best fits their needs. Hardware wallets, for instance, are often favored for storing significant amounts of cryptocurrency due to their enhanced security features. Furthermore, this mindset encourages users to be vigilant against phishing scams, social engineering tactics, and other forms of cybercrime. They understand that in the world of decentralized finance, the responsibility for security ultimately rests with the individual. This proactive approach to security not only protects their existing wealth but also instills confidence in their ability to navigate the digital landscape safely and effectively.
